Ordinals
alpha
Address 3LZExoMcXxoXHBsad2ww6zAF2vmyZmEFnm
sat balance
5652
runes balances
outputs
69500010217a41bdc54aac6d97340a76eb58005ee81c2558a580bcba45771e58:0